The Legal Framework of Electronic Signatures in Licensing Agreements
The legal framework overseeing electronic signatures in licensing agreements is primarily established by legislation such as the Electronic Signatures in Global and National Commerce Act (ESIGN Act) in the United States. This act affirms that electronic signatures have the same legal status as traditional handwritten signatures, provided certain criteria are met. Its purpose is to facilitate commerce by promoting the validity and enforceability of digital agreements across various industries, including licensing transactions.
The ESIGN Act requires that electronic signatures are attributable to the signer, and that signers intend to sign electronically. This intent can be demonstrated through various methods, such as clicking an "I agree" button or using a digital certificate. Additionally, the legal framework emphasizes the importance of recordkeeping to ensure that electronic signatures and associated documents are preserved in a manner that maintains their integrity and legality.
Internationally, frameworks such as eIDAS in the European Union extend similar legal recognition to electronic signatures, providing harmonized standards for licensing agreements in cross-border transactions. Overall, the legal framework for electronic signatures aims to create a reliable environment in which digital agreements are recognized, enforceable, and fulfill the same legal requirements as their paper counterparts.

Essential Features of Valid Electronic Signatures for Licensing Contracts
Valid electronic signatures for licensing contracts must demonstrate authenticity, integrity, and non-repudiation. These features ensure that the signature genuinely originates from the signer and the document remains unaltered during transmission, establishing trust in digital transactions.
Authenticity involves verifying the identity of the signer, often through digital certificates or secure login credentials. It confirms that the individual signing the agreement is authorized and accountable for their actions. Integrity guarantees that the document has not been modified after signing, which is typically achieved via cryptographic techniques such as hash functions.
Non-repudiation prevents the signer from denying their participation in the agreement. This is accomplished through secure audit trails, timestamping, and digital signatures that are legally recognized under frameworks like the Electronic Signatures in Global and National Commerce Act. Together, these features underpin the validity of electronic signatures in licensing agreements.

Ensuring Security and Authenticity in Licensing Agreements through Digital Signatures
Digital signatures play a vital role in ensuring security and authenticity within licensing agreements. They utilize cryptographic techniques to verify the identity of the signer, providing a high level of assurance that the document has not been tampered with since signing.
Implementing strong encryption measures enhances data integrity and confidentiality, safeguarding sensitive licensing information from unauthorized access or alteration. This security framework helps prevent fraud and unauthorized modifications, which are critical concerns in licensing transactions.
Moreover, digital signatures generate a unique digital fingerprint, or hash, of the document. This feature allows all parties to verify the document’s authenticity and detect any modifications made after signing. Such mechanisms increase trust in electronic licensing agreements, aligning with legal standards.
Compliance with established legal frameworks, such as the Electronic Signatures in Global and National Commerce Act, further supports the legal validity of digital signatures. Ensuring security and authenticity in licensing agreements through these measures fosters confidence and smooth international and domestic licensing processes.
Recordkeeping and Evidence: Maintaining Legality of Electronic Signatures in Licensing
Maintaining proper recordkeeping and evidence is vital for ensuring the legality of electronic signatures in licensing agreements. Reliable records bolster the enforceability of electronically signed documents by providing proof of signature authenticity and intent.
Organizations should implement secure archiving systems that store electronic signatures, signed documents, and related metadata. These records must be tamper-evident, timestamped, and easily retrievable for future verification or legal disputes.
Key elements include:
- Digital audit trails documenting each signer’s identity, signing action, and timestamp.
- Secure storage that prevents unauthorized access or alteration.
- Regular backups to ensure data preservation over time.
Adhering to these practices helps licensing parties demonstrate compliance with legal standards and the provisions of the Electronic Signatures in Global and National Commerce Act. Maintaining detailed, accurate records supports the legitimacy of electronic signatures as legally binding evidence in licensing disputes.

Best Practices for Legally Binding Electronic Signatures in Licensing Contracts
To ensure electronic signatures in licensing contracts are legally binding, parties should verify their identity using secure authentication methods such as multi-factor authentication or digital certificates. This reduces the risk of fraud and confirms signatory authority.
Adopting a clear and consistent process for capturing electronic signatures helps maintain authenticity. Using platforms that provide detailed audit trails and tamper-evident features strengthens the enforceability of licensing agreements.
Maintaining comprehensive records of signed documents and related communications is vital. Proper recordkeeping ensures that electronic signatures can serve as valid evidence in legal disputes, aligning with statutory requirements under laws like the Electronic Signatures in Global and National Commerce Act.
It is also advisable to incorporate contractual clauses affirming the validity and enforceability of electronic signatures, clarifying the parties’ consent to electronic execution. This step reinforces the legal integrity of licensing agreements executed digitally.
